Cactus is a very unique and popular plant. Cactus has many different species, each of which has a different appearance. These plants grow in dry and hot climates and unlike many plants, they do not need much water. By storing water in itself, cactus can survive in drought conditions.
Although cacti love sunlight, many of them can grow indoors. These types of cacti need less light and their size is smaller. For this reason, they will be great as a houseplant.
1. Cactus Optopontia Microdasis (Rabbit Ear Cactus)
The main habitat of this plant is Mexico. This plant has two pads that are shaped like rabbit ears. These pads are covered with brown blades. This plant can grow about 60 to 90 cm. In summer, if this plant is exposed to enough light, it will produce white flowers and purple fruits.

1. Cactus Mamlaria Haniana (Old Lady Cactus)
The old lady cactus is a prickly cactus in the Mamillaria family, which has 250 species. This plant has tendrils and small pink or purple flowers in spring. The soil of this flower should be a combination of potting soil and sand, and it should be watered every other week.
1. Star Cactus (Astro Phytum Astrisias)
This cactus has a round shape that is divided into 8 parts. The star cactus is covered with white hairs and small white dots. In spring, it produces a yellow flower. This cactus is only 5 to 15 cm in diameter and is suitable for keeping at home.

1. Easter Cactus
This cactus is native to Brazil and flowers in late winter and early spring. Its flowers are white, orange and pale purple. The blades of this plant are stacked on top of each other and give it a unique appearance.
